The 860 Life Take

Erector Square hosts Kim Weston's powerful photo exhibition exploring Black and Native American experiences. The show dives into overlooked narratives and knowledge gaps in American history through compelling imagery. It’s a thoughtful cultural moment in a vibrant Hartford arts hub.
